Output 8c52388a0455c0e204d1c11fd456245d018a9c8f01628e97cb730ab9f9b26d09:0

value
2466083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c62c704b21597d8d0c65ce9215d7e6d73e5f5f7a OP_EQUAL
address
3KkrxBFDz1Ud7g52wMXDAgCHTh2i48zB3E
transaction
8c52388a0455c0e204d1c11fd456245d018a9c8f01628e97cb730ab9f9b26d09
spent
true